Skip to content

Instantly share code, notes, and snippets.

@D-side
Forked from ryanburnette/_syntax.sass
Last active May 19, 2016 17:13
Show Gist options
  • Save D-side/3054ce947676bd621ce6 to your computer and use it in GitHub Desktop.
Save D-side/3054ce947676bd621ce6 to your computer and use it in GitHub Desktop.
// Jekyll Pygments syntax highlighter styles
// Color scheme
$base03: #002B36
$base02: #073642
$base01: #586E75
$base00: #657B83
$base0: #839496
$base1: #93A1A1
$base2: #EEE8D5
$base3: #FDF6E3
$yellow: #B58900
$orange: #CB4B16
$red: #dc322f
$magenta: #d33682
$violet: #6c71c4
$blue: #268bd2
$cyan: #2aa198
$green: #859900
// Colors
$default: $base3
$background: $base03
$comment: $base01
$error: $base01
$generic: $base1
$keyword: $green
$literal: $base1
$name: $base1
$operator: $green
$other: $orange
$punctuation: $base1
$commentmultiline: $base01
$commentpreproc: $green
$commentsingle: $base01
$commentspecial: $green
$genericdeleted: $cyan
$genericemph: $base1
$genericerror: $red
$genericheading: $orange
$genericinserted: $green
$genericoutput: $base1
$genericprompt: $base1
$genericstrong: $base1
$genericsubheading: $orange
$generictraceback: $base1
$keywordconstant: $orange
$keywordeclaration: $blue
$keywordnamespace: $green
$keywordpseudo: $green
$keywordreserved: $blue
$keywordtype: $red
$literaldate: $base1
$literalnumber: $cyan
$literalstring: $cyan
$nameattribute: $base1
$namebuiltin: $yellow
$nameclass: $blue
$nameconstant: $orange
$namedecorator: $blue
$nameentity: $orange
$nameexception: $orange
$namefunction: $blue
$namelabel: $base1
$namenamespace: $base1
$nameother: $base00
$nameproperty: $base1
$nametag: $blue
$namevariable: $blue
$operatorword: $green
$textwhitespace: $base1
$literalnumberfloat: $cyan
$literalnumberhex: $cyan
$literalnumberinteger: $cyan
$literalnumberoct: $cyan
$literalstringbacktick: $base01
$literalstringchar: $cyan
$literalstringdoc: $base1
$literalstringdouble: $cyan
$literalstringescape: $orange
$literalstringheredoc: $base1
$literalstringinterpol: $cyan
$literalstringother: $cyan
$literalstringregex: $red
$literalstringsingle: $cyan
$literalstringsymbol: $cyan
$namebuiltinpseudo: $blue
$namevariableclass: $blue
$namevariableglobal: $blue
$namevariableinstance: $blue
$literalnumberintegerlong: $cyan
.highlight
font-family: Monaco, monospace
font-size: 1em
line-height: 1.6em
font-weight: bold
background: $background
color: $default
pre
padding: 1em
span.lineno
margin-right: 0.6em
code, pre
margin: 1em 0 1.5em 0
.c
color: $comment
.err
color: $error
.g
color: $generic
.k
color: $keyword
.l
color: $literal
.n
color: $name
.o
color: $operator
.x
color: $other
.p
color: $punctuation
.cm
color: $commentmultiline
.cp
color: $commentpreproc
.c1
color: $commentsingle
.cs
color: $commentspecial
.gd
color: $genericdeleted
.ge
color: $genericemph
font-style: italic
.gr
color: $genericerror
.gh
color: $genericheading
.gi
color: $genericinserted
.go
color: $genericoutput
.gp
color: $genericprompt
.gs
color: $genericstrong
font-weight: bold
.gu
color: $genericsubheading
.gt
color: $generictraceback
.kc
color: $keywordconstant
.kd
color: $keywordeclaration
.kn
color: $keywordnamespace
.kp
color: $keywordpseudo
.kr
color: $keywordreserved
.kt
color: $keywordtype
.ld
color: $literaldate
.m
color: $literalnumber
.s
color: $literalstring
.na
color: $nameattribute
.nb
color: $namebuiltin
.nc
color: $nameclass
.no
color: $nameconstant
.nd
color: $namedecorator
.ni
color: $nameentity
.ne
color: $nameexception
.nf
color: $namefunction
.nl
color: $namelabel
.nn
color: $namenamespace
.nx
color: $nameother
.py
color: $nameproperty
.nt
color: $nametag
.nv
color: $namevariable
.ow
color: $operatorword
.w
color: $textwhitespace
.mf
color: $literalnumberfloat
.mh
color: $literalnumberhex
.mi
color: $literalnumberinteger
.mo
color: $literalnumberoct
.sb
color: $literalstringbacktick
.sc
color: $literalstringchar
.sd
color: $literalstringdoc
.s2
color: $literalstringdouble
.se
color: $literalstringescape
.sh
color: $literalstringheredoc
.si
color: $literalstringinterpol
.sx
color: $literalstringother
.sr
color: $literalstringregex
.s1
color: $literalstringsingle
.ss
color: $literalstringsymbol
.bp
color: $namebuiltinpseudo
.vc
color: $namevariableclass
.vg
color: $namevariableglobal
.vi
color: $namevariableinstance
.il
color: $literalnumberintegerlong
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ment